The first-ever IPL final was played between Rajasthan Royals (RR) and Chennai Super Kings (CSK) on June 1, 2008, at the DY Patil Stadium, Navi Mumbai.
IPL 2008 Final Details:
-
Teams: Rajasthan Royals (RR) vs Chennai Super Kings (CSK)
-
Venue: DY Patil Stadium, Navi Mumbai
-
Final Score:
-
CSK: 163/5 (20 overs)
-
RR: 164/7 (20 overs)
-
Result: Rajasthan Royals won by 3 wickets
-
Winning Captain: Shane Warne (RR)
-
Player of the Match: Yusuf Pathan (56 off 39 balls, 3 wickets)
This victory made Rajasthan Royals the first-ever IPL champions under the leadership of Shane Warne.
